The storehouse held army rations and supplies. Food staples included salt pork, dried beef, corn, beans, rice, and coffee, along with condiments such as salt, brown sugar, vinegar, and molasses. For an army such as the one that built Fort Christmas, equipment and supplies were substantial and included building tools and materials, plus the items needed to keep the army in good repair. Articles required for an advanced depot by order of General Thomas S. Jesup are listed inside the storehouse.
